 Authentic Shahi Paneer Recipe: From Indian Cuisine

Introduction:

Shahi paneer is a very popular dish in India.I think it originated from Mughalai cuisine. Overall, this Makhani dish is the soul of Indian cuisine today. It is the most popular dish eaten during festivals especially in North India.
 Perfect for special occasions or when you want to treat yourself to something indulgent, Shahi Paneer is sure to delight your taste buds with its royal essence.

Ingredients:
– 250 grams paneer, cut into cubes
– 2 large onions, finely chopped
– 2 tomatoes, pureed
– 10 to 12 cashews soaked in water.
– 1/4 cup cream
– 1/4 cup milk
– 2 tablespoons Butter or oil
– 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
– 1 teaspoon ginger-garlic paste
– 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
– 1 teaspoon red chili powder (adjust to taste)
– 1 teaspoon coriander powder
– 1/2 teaspoon garam masala powder
– 1/2 teaspoon kasuri Methi  Crushed 
– Salt to taste
– Fresh coriander leaves for garnish

Instructions:

1. Prepare the Shahi Paste:
– Grind the soaked cashew nuts with a little water to form a smooth paste. Set aside.

2. Fry the Paneer:
– Heat 1 tablespoon of Butter or oil in a pan on medium Flame
– You can lightly fry the paneer or use it without frying it.

3. Make the Shahi Sauce:
– In same pan, add a  tablespoon of Butter or oil.
-Heat ghee in a pan and fry the cumin seeds for a few moments.
-After that add finely chopped onion and fry it till it turns brown .

4. Add Spices:
-Then stir the ginger garlic paste in the vessel until the aroma comes out .
-Then add turmeric, coriander, red chili powder, mix and cook well. .

5. Incorporate Tomato Puree:
– Now add the grinded tomato puree and cook well until the oil separates.

6. Blend in Shahi Paste:
– Add the prepared cashew nut paste and mix well with the masala. Cook for 2-3 minutes.

7. Create Creamy Base:
– Reduce the heat to low.Now add cream and milk little by little and mix it while stirring.

8. Season and Simmer:
-Now add garam masala, salt, crushed kasuri methi and cook well .
-Add paneer or fried paneer here and stir it for a while so that the paneer absorbs the spices well.

9. Garnish and Serve:
– Garnish with fresh coriander leaves.
– Serve Shahi Paneer hot with naan, roti, or steamed rice.
